Since 2009, autobau in Romanshorn has been providing an insight into the world of rare and fast sports cars. On Sunday, the autobau team welcomed the 100,000th guest to the special exhibition on Lake Constance.
"We now have more visitors than exhibited horsepower," smiled Fredy Lienhard, delighted with the 100,000th guest. The great interest in the vehicle exhibition is a nice natural dividend for the former racing driver and entrepreneur. It is also confirmation that he is right to share his enthusiasm.
Rising visitor numbers
A visit from a school class motivated Fredy Lienhard to show his car collection to the public. With the opening of the autobau Erlebniswelt in 2009 in the former tank farm in Romanshorn, he fulfilled his wish. Initially open one Sunday a month, autobau's doors are now open every Sunday and Wednesday. Groups can also visit at any time by prior arrangement.
Various special exhibitions and the new exhibition space in the historic steel tank have inspired and continue to inspire more and more people. On average, over 1,000 visitors a month experience the unique car world in the port city of Romanshorn.
Growing car world
With autobau, the automotive industry has also found a home: a modern commercial center was opened in the autobau Factory in 2011. A perfect addition to the exhibition, where the theme of cars and motor racing can be experienced.
